Question : Assertion (A): Dissolution of the firm means the dissolution of the partnership between all the partners of the firm.

Reason (R): Dissolution of the firm means the closure of business and therefore means dissolution of partnership also.

Option 1: Assertion (A) and Reason (R) are correct but the Reason (R) is not the correct explanation of Assertion (A)

Option 2: Both, Assertion (A) and Reason (R) are correct and Reason (R) is the correct explanation of Assertion (A).

Option 3: Only Assertion (A) is correct.

Option 4: Both Assertion (A) and Reason (R) are not correct

Correct Answer: Both, Assertion (A) and Reason (R) are correct and Reason (R) is the correct explanation of Assertion (A).


Solution : The firm's business ends upon dissolution because all of its affairs are settled through the sale of its assets, payment of its debts, and satisfaction of the partners' claims. The term "firm dissolution" refers to the end of a partnership between all partners of a company.

Hence the correct answer is option 2.
